Are there any rolling handles currently on the market that have stainless steel handles? 

I don't really want plastic (just personal preference), and I live in a very humid country so plain carbon steel rusts super fast (I still like how FBBC Crushers look..).

I can't seem to find a stainless one, but maybe you guys can suggest a small shop or something. 

If there is none, I will either design my own, or just go with a painted/coated one like AASS's one-hand nightmare or GoG's Godlike handle.
